Created complex video pipelines and now design reusable IP-based FPGA projects efficiently
The best features of AMD Vivado Design Suite is that it is a mature tool with a very good GUI. The most fascinating feature is its block design feature, which allows me to add and drop various IPs from AMD Vivado Design Suite's IP catalog and create a block design for my video designs. That is the one feature that I find very interesting. It is also very easy to source control AMD Vivado Design Suite projects using Git. The IP catalog is another valuable feature, and it is a very good tool that I install on all of my employees' project devices.

Rapid database cloning has accelerated realistic testing but initial setup still needs simplification
I only used DBLab Engine for a while, but I already see many benefits. I can think of applications not only in the hackathon, but we can also probably do some black-box monitoring, set up some simulation environments, and I think it is very helpful to have this kind of automatic testing to ensure that whenever our new feature is delivered, there are no regressions. In my experience, the absolute best feature of DBLab Engine is the thin cloning capability driven by copy-on-write technology. Being able to provide a full-size production-scale database clone in just a few seconds, regardless of whether the underlying database is tens of gigabytes or multiple terabytes, is a massive game-changer for engineering velocity. I really would to try more. The complete environment isolation is also very fantastic. I have noticed that the thin cloning and environmental isolation of DBLab Engine have dramatically accelerated our development lifecycle and improved overall code quality, even in a hackathon. Before utilizing this, setting up a realistic test database was a major bottleneck. Developers either had to share a single staging database or spend hours trying to seed a local database with a thin, representative subset of mock data. With DBLab Engine, we achieved complete workflow interdependence, which was incredibly helpful.
